## Deploy Guide — Step 4: FlagPilot Rollout Push

After the canary cohort reports healthy for 15 minutes, promote the flag bundle to the full fleet. Support staff should confirm the bundle's signature before promotion, since unsigned bundles are silently ignored by edge nodes. Verify against the current deploy key, shown here.

signing key of bagap-yawep = bky13_TbfT6ZMUoGJo2

**Q: How do I get into the first-aid room?**

The first-aid room at Copperleaf Exchange is on the ground floor beside the lift lobby, marked with a green cross. During office hours (08:00–18:00) the door is unlocked and a trained first-aider is usually nearby. Outside those hours the room is kept locked to protect supplies, but access must never be delayed in an emergency. In that case, any staff member may open the door using the keypad code below.

door code, kawip-bagap: bdg-HQEWH-4

Handover: Givnote receipt mailer. Batch run moved to 02:00 to dodge the tax-season queue backlog. Duplicate receipts from last week were reissued; affected donors already notified. If a donor reports a missing receipt, requeue it — don't regenerate manually. The requeue tool and delivery log live on the internal page here.

operations page: https://jenkins.zemvarcloud.local/job/merge_requests/repo/build/73930b4b30f0a8ed

## Runbook: Retiring the Quillbatch queue

We are replacing the homegrown Quillbatch job queue with the managed Ferrowline broker. Plugin authors: jobs enqueued through the legacy API are transparently bridged until the freeze date, after which the shim is removed. Retry semantics change — Ferrowline retries with exponential backoff rather than fixed intervals, so long-running plugins should make handlers idempotent. Test against the staging broker before the freeze. The bridge currently runs with these configuration values.

config for yajep-tafof:
[rusath]
team = julmir
access_code = ac_fe37fd
host = rusath.novactech.test
port = 8000
owner = pelmir.weneth
peer = oliwyn.olvarqdyn.internal